In the Circle of Life on Earth, soil is the beginning and the end.  

Today, this Circle is broken, and one consequence is a plague of degenerative diseases.  Our cure isn’t pills or potions, but the regeneration of soil.  Essential ingredients of living soils are carbon, nitrogen, minerals & microbes.  Carbon-Smart Farming provides a simple recipe to create fully fertile soil to grow nutrient-dense food and show us what true abundance looks and tastes like.

We will learn & practice how to regenerate soil to grow Nutrient-Dense, High-Brix Foods by balanced elements, added biocarbon and inoculation by a full diversity of microbes.  Like baking bread, soil building requires the right ingredients in proportioned amounts, combined & applied by proper procedure.

MINERALS: Soil begins  as rock.  Primary elements from rocks are The Mineral Foundation for biology.  Complete minerals, properly balanced, sets soil pH (acid/alkali balance = voltage) to optimize plant growth and fire up immunity to make disease and pests irrelevant.  We will learn how to boost and balance the seven major minerals and complete the trace elements.

BIOCHAR: We will use fire to make biochar, a special form of super-stable carbon that increases storage and cycling of water, nutrients, electric charge, bacteria, fungi & earthworms.  Fresh-made biochar is bone-dry and sterile, so we will prepare biochar for soil with the 4 M’s:  Micronize, Moisten, Mineralize & Microbe inoculation.

COMPOST:  Soil is a digestive organ to feed bioactive compost to breakdown organic matter into nutrients, and also deliver minerals & microbes.  We will learn how to make Premium Quality Compost able to inoculate soils and deliver steady supplies of natural organic nutrients.

ORGANIC MATTER: Soils need shade & sugars from mulches & cover crops to provide a cool, moist environment to conserve moisture, shelter microbes & nurture roots.  Living soil covers provide a Green Carbon Pathway to assure sugars, amino acids & other bionutrients to sustain soil microbes and plant growth.

MICROBES: Our ultimate goal is to nurture & culture thriving, living Communities of Micro-organisms in soil.  Microbes are “cheap labor” to maintain stable pH, build soil pore structure, digest rock minerals, cycle nutrients, and assure vigorous, healthy plant growth.

WATER:  First & final ingredient is water, whose gift to life is to flow and move. and form electrolytes with minerals.  Water not only delivers chemistry to microbes, seeds & plants, but also Structured Subtle Energy to activate minerals, organize molecules & biology.
